The Affordable Care Act (ACA) included
an individual mandate stipulating that effective January 1, 2014, people must
have insurance meeting minimum essential coverage or pay a penalty at tax
time. Consumers can enroll for coverage
through a special enrollment period that will run from March 15 through April
30 if they attest that they became aware of the penalty during this income tax filing
season.
This is the first time that consumers
will be asked to provide basic information
regarding health coverage on their
federal tax returns. Because this requirement is new, some Marylanders are
unaware of the requirement and the fee.
